Columbia Collective Wedding Price
Columbia Collective wedding venue in Woodinville offers a range of pricing options tailored to different event needs. Rental fees typically start around $5,000 per event, with variations depending on factors such as the day of the week, time of year, and specific spaces reserved. The venue features three distinct areas: the Ballroom, which accommodates up to 500 guests; the Barrel Room, with a capacity of 800; and the Tasting Room, which can host 350 guests. Together, these spaces can accommodate up to 1,800 guests, providing flexibility for both intimate gatherings and large celebrations.
